Output 75df2944ab101c0fe12a5a488605aec3ca037b461659dba02dfbfe875b531692:68

value
1658544
script pubkey
OP_0 OP_PUSHBYTES_20 e8b339a7a80d4dee54b1e8d301f3f18e2bcd4da7
address
bc1qazennfagp4x7u493arfsrul33c4u6nd8zf9d00
transaction
75df2944ab101c0fe12a5a488605aec3ca037b461659dba02dfbfe875b531692
spent
true